Objectives

To enable students to,

  1. understand the process of anti-differentiation.;
  2. recognize the problem of calculating areas bounded by non-linear function;
  3. understand how the limit of the sum of rectangles may be used to calculate the area bounded by a function;
  4. understand the meaning of ;
  5. calculate the area under a function between two extremes;
  6. apply knowledge and skills relating to anti-differentiation to solve problems;
  7. verify that the area bounded by the curve y=f(x), x=a, x=b and x-axis =

Prerequisites/Instructions, prior preparations, if any

Knowledge on plotting graphs, differentiation, mapping and computing functions.
